AIC1528
APPLICATION INFORMATION
Error Flag
An error Flag is an open-drained output of an
N-channel MOSFET. FLG output is pulled low to
signal the following fault conditions: input
undervoltage, output current limit, and thermal
shutdown.
Current Limit
The current limit threshold is preset internally. It
protects the output MOSFET switches from
damage resulting from undesirable short circuit
conditions or excess inrush current, which is
often encountered during hot plug-in. The low
limit of the current limit threshold of the AIC1528
allows a minimum current of 1A through the
MOSFET switches. The error flag signals when
any current limit conditions occur.
Thermal Shutdown
When temperature of AIC1528 exceeds 135°C
for any reasons, the thermal shutdown function
turns both MOSFET switches off and signals the
error flag. A hysteresis of 10°C prevents the
MOSFETs from turning back on until the chip
temperature drops below 125°C. However, if
thermal shutdown is triggered by chip
temperature rise resulting from overcurrent fault
condition of either one of the MOSFET switches,
the thermal shutdown function will only turn off
the switch that is in overcurrent condition and
the other switch can still remain its normal
operation. In other words, the thermal shutdown
function of the two switches is independent of
each other in the case of overcurrent fault.
Supply Filtering
A 0.1µF to 1µF bypass capacitor from IN to GND,
located near the device, is strongly
recommended to control supply transients.
Without a bypass capacitor, an output short may
cause sufficient ringing on the input (from supply
lead inductance) to damage internal control
circuitry.
Transient Requirements
USB supports dynamic attachment (hot plug-in)
of peripherals. A current surge is caused by the
input capacitance of downstream device. Ferrite
beads are recommended in series with all power
and ground connector pins. Ferrite beads
reduce EMI and limit the inrush current during
hot-attachment by filtering high-frequency
signals.
Short Circuit Transient
Bulk capacitance provides the short-term
transient current needed during a
hot-attachment event. A 33µF/16V tantalum or a
100µF/10V electrolytic capacitor mounted close
to downstream connector each port should
provide transient drop protection.
Printed Circuit Layout
The power circuitry of USB printed circuit boards
requires a customized layout to maximize
thermal dissipation and to minimize voltage drop
and EMI.
